javajava枚举模板
Posted Angel挤一挤
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了javajava枚举模板相关的知识,希望对你有一定的参考价值。
今日份:
/** * @Author: SXD * @Description: 操作枚举 * @Date: create in 2020/3/18 16:11 */ public enum OperateTypeEnum { ADD(1,"新增"), EDIT(2,"编辑"), VIEW(3,"查看"), REAPPLY(4,"重新申请"), COPY(5,"复制"); private Integer value; private String desc; OperateTypeEnum(Integer type, String desc) { this.value = type; this.desc = desc; } public Integer getValue() { return value; } public String getDesc() { return desc; } /** * 根据value值获取枚举对象 * @param value * @return */ public static OperateTypeEnum getOperateType(Integer value){ OperateTypeEnum[] instances = OperateTypeEnum.values(); for(OperateTypeEnum instance : instances){ if(instance.getValue() == value){ return instance; } } return null; } }
=============
以上是关于javajava枚举模板的主要内容,如果未能解决你的问题,请参考以下文章